MariaDB - Relay log read failure: Could not parse relay log event entry


Getting the following error when checking slave status

Relay log read failure: Could not parse relay log event entry. The possible reasons are: the master's binary log is corrupted (you can check this by running 'mysqlbinlog' on the binary log), the slave's relay log is corrupted (you can check this by running 'mysqlbinlog' on the relay log), a network problem, or a bug in the master's or slave's MySQL code. If you want to check the master's binary log or slave's relay log, you will be able to know their names by issuing 'SHOW SLAVE STATUS' on this slave.

I am using Bitnami's MariaDB with Replication where I have 1 Master and 2 Slave nodes out of which one node seems corrupted and the above error is appearing.

Explaining the steps that I took post which the node stopped working

  1. There was a system_user query that was stuck, tried killing it but unfortunately it was not getting deleted.
  2. Restarted the slave node so that all queries get refreshed.
  3. Post server restart, MySQL stopped working and was giving a socket error.

Solution

  • I have solved same issue with bellow steps.

    To check the current slave status execute command:

    show slave status\G
    

    You should see result similar to this:

    Important values you should notice are Relay_Master_Log_File and Exec_Master_Log_Pos. You will need them to correctly restart replication on your slave.

    To restart replication execute following commands:

    STOP SLAVE;
    
    RESET SLAVE;
    
    CHANGE MASTER TO master_log_file='mysql-bin.000149', master_log_pos=884187951;
    
    START SLAVE;
    

    To check if replication is working again, execute again command:

    show slave status\G
    

    Before you will call your slave as synced, check value of parameter Seconds_Behind_Master from the status command. In our case I have seen value (7971 seconds):

    Seconds_Behind_Master: 7971

    Within next few minutes was replication synced again with master and replication lag was 0s

    Note : For safety backup your database first
